LASIK With Astigmatism


If you have astigmatism, LASIK may be an alternative for you. The surgical treatment deals with astigmatism, which creates blurry vision, by reshaping the cornea itself.

The reshaping of the cornea reroutes light so that it hits the retina (light-sensitive tissue at the back of your eye) in an extra exact method. It likewise compensates for other refractive mistakes, like nearsightedness and also farsightedness, in which the centerpiece is either in front of or behind your retina as opposed to on it.

For most clients, LASIK can deal with approximately 6.00 diopters of astigmatism in one treatment. Nevertheless, some astigmatism can be too serious for LASIK, so it is very important to review your choices with your eye doctor.

LASIK is an outpatient treatment and generally takes less than 5 minutes per eye. After your eye doctor administers eye-numbing declines, the laser is utilized to reshape your cornea and remedy your astigmatism.

LASIK Improvement


LASIK enhancement is a sort of laser eye surgical treatment that is done to correct a vision trouble that wasn't dealt with by your main LASIK procedure. This can be triggered by a refractive mistake or a concern with the flap developed throughout your very first surgery.



Your Kansas City eye doctor or eye doctor will certainly evaluate your eyes and identify whether you are a great prospect for LASIK improvement. This will certainly be based upon a range of factors, including your corneal thickness, the level of refractive mistake and also your overall wellness.

The improvement treatment entails re-lifting your corneal flap. This procedure is pain-free and also takes about 2 mins. Your surgeon then makes use of an excimer laser to reshape your cornea. Only very little extra improving is essential in the majority of improvements.
